Hello all, For the last couple of weeks, we have been conducting the second round of beta tests for our new forums <https://testforums.evegate.com/>. The feedback we have received has been tremendously helpful, and we are grateful to those of you who have taken the opportunity to help us with the beta test. We have decided to extend the test until July 8, 2011, at which time we will close the beta test forums. Originally, we had planned to close the test forums much sooner, and wanted to deploy the new forums over the final week of June, however, we feel that doing so at this time would be detrimental to the ongoing discussions regarding both CCP and the current state of EVE Online. WeÆve been listening to and following your concerns and criticisms closely, and do not want to risk disrupting the flow of discussion by opening new forums. We plan on deploying the new forums in August. Until then...
Fly safely! Team OccamÆs Razor and the EVE Online Community Team

Originally by: El'Niaga A wise decision to delay but frankly I see no need for new forums, money spent developing them should of been spent on other things I believe.
I do applaud you realizing that if you wiped the forums in the next few days that you'd face a massive backlash just like SOE suffered when they wiped their forums during the NGE debacle in 2005.
The forums we use now severely lack not only basic features modern forums have (e.g. search), but barely have tools that work from the Community Management perspective (e.g. the delete thread button doesn't actually delete threads).
When we do move over to the new forums, we'll be keeping this instance open for a few days, and then archiving the material so that no data is lost.
